What Defines the Role of an Electrical Accident Lawyer?
An electrical accident lawyer is a premises liability attorney who focuses on cases involving electrical shock caused by hazardous conditions. These claims fall under premises liability law when they involve dangerous conditions on someone else's land. The lawyer's role is to prove that a legal obligation existed, that it was violated, and that the breach directly caused your injuries.
Procedurally, the process of an electrical accident lawyer requires a multi-layered investigation. That means reviewing maintenance logs, retaining expert witnesses such as electrical engineers, examining the scene of the accident, and documenting exactly why the electrical hazard was created. Evidence of prior complaints, code citations, or ignored repair orders can significantly strengthen your claim.
Beyond investigation, an electrical accident lawyer handles all communication with liable parties. Insurance companies routinely downplay electrical injury claims because the hidden nature of electrical trauma makes quantifying the full extent of harm challenging. A skilled lawyer understands how to document medical evidence — including psychological trauma — so that adjusters cannot reduce the true impact of your injuries.

Who Is a Qualified Candidate for an Electrical Accident Lawyer?
Anyone injured by an electrical hazard on a third party's premises could have a valid premises liability claim. Ideal candidates include laborers shocked by code-violating wiring on a jobsite beyond what is covered by workers' compensation, apartment dwellers shocked by dangerous panel boxes in rental units, and guests injured at commercial properties where exposed wiring created an unnecessary risk.
You may also have a strong claim if your family member was hurt by exposed electrical hazards in a public park, or if a faulty product contributed to the electrical accident. In these situations, liability may involve the manufacturer or retailer in addition to the property owner. An electrical accident lawyer examines all aspects of your claim to confirm every available legal theory.
Not every electrical incident automatically results in a viable claim. When the harm was caused by your own intentional misuse, recovery might not be available. Likewise, where the victim was present without permission, the legal picture changes. Our attorneys will offer an candid assessment of your specific situation during your first consultation.

How do I know if the property owner is at fault for my electrical injury?Liability generally copyrights on whether the property owner was aware or reasonably should have been aware about the unsafe wiring and did not address it within a appropriate period. Documentation including prior incident records, regulatory citations, or ignored repair requests can establish that notice existed. Your electrical accident lawyer investigates all relevant evidence to make this determination for your specific case.
What if my actions played some role in the electrical accident?Nevada follows a comparative negligence system, which means you can remain eligible for compensation as long as you were not more than half responsible for the accident. Any damages awarded would be decreased by the share of blame assigned to you.
